Giving Philosophy

The trust prioritises supporting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ples through culturally-informed philanthropy that respects Indigenous self-determination and community leadership. Its focus on both culture and social welfare suggests a holistic approach to Indigenous wellbeing that values cultural preservation alongside practical community support.

Wealth Source:Community or trust-based funding; specific wealth origins not publicly documented

Tips for Applicants

Applicants should demonstrate direct benefit to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ander communities, particularly in Western Australia, and articulate how their work supports cultural continuity or social welfare outcomes. Organisations with strong Indigenous leadership or governance structures are likely to align well with this funder's values.
